我们提供融合门户系统招投标所需全套资料,包括融合系统介绍PPT、融合门户系统产品解决方案、
融合门户系统产品技术参数,以及对应的标书参考文件,详请联系客服。
张伟:你好,李明,最近我在研究一个关于综合信息门户的项目,感觉它和数据分析有挺多关联的。
李明:是啊,张伟。综合信息门户其实是一个集成了多种数据来源、提供统一访问入口的平台,而数据分析则是从这些数据中提取有价值的信息。两者的结合可以提升数据的利用效率。

张伟:那你是怎么理解“源码”在这里的作用呢?是不是说我们要从源码层面去开发这个系统?

李明:没错,源码指的是系统的原始代码,通常包括前端、后端以及数据库的设计。如果我们要构建一个高效的数据分析平台,源码的结构和实现方式就显得非常重要了。
张伟:那源码具体是怎么影响数据分析的呢?比如,有没有什么最佳实践或者常见问题需要注意?
李明:这个问题很好。首先,源码的可维护性和扩展性决定了系统是否能够适应不断变化的数据需求。例如,如果源码设计得不够灵活,后续添加新的数据源或分析模块就会变得非常困难。
张伟:那你们在开发过程中有没有遇到过一些技术上的挑战?比如数据量太大导致性能问题?
李明:确实有。我们在处理大量数据时,发现传统的单机架构已经无法满足需求。于是我们采用了分布式计算框架,比如Hadoop或Spark,来提升数据处理能力。
张伟:听起来很先进。不过,这种架构对源码有什么要求呢?是不是需要重新设计整个系统?
李明:是的,分布式架构对源码的结构和模块化提出了更高的要求。我们需要将数据处理逻辑拆分成独立的组件,并确保它们之间可以通过网络进行通信。
张伟:那在源码层面,有没有什么工具或者框架可以帮助我们更好地进行数据分析?
李明:当然有。比如,Python的Pandas库非常适合做数据清洗和预处理,而Django或Spring Boot这样的框架则能帮助我们快速搭建数据接口。
张伟:我听说有些公司会使用开源的综合信息门户系统,比如Liferay或者Joomla,这些系统是否适合用来做数据分析?
李明:这类系统确实提供了丰富的功能,但它们的源码通常是为通用用途设计的,可能并不完全适合特定的数据分析需求。因此,我们通常会基于这些系统进行二次开发,以满足定制化的数据分析需求。
张伟:那二次开发的时候,需要注意哪些方面呢?有没有什么经验可以分享?
李明:我觉得最重要的是保持源码的清晰和模块化。另外,要确保所有新增的功能都符合原有系统的架构规范,避免引入不必要的耦合。
张伟:明白了。那在实际部署中,有没有什么性能优化的技巧?比如缓存、索引之类的?
李明:当然有。我们通常会在数据库层面上建立索引,提高查询速度;同时,也会在应用层使用缓存机制,减少重复计算和数据库访问。
张伟:听起来很实用。那有没有什么安全方面的考虑?毕竟涉及到大量数据,不能出错。
李明:安全确实很重要。我们一般会采用权限控制、数据加密和审计日志等手段来保障数据的安全性。此外,源码本身也需要经过严格的代码审查,防止漏洞的存在。
张伟:那你认为,未来综合信息门户和源码在数据分析方面会有哪些发展趋势?
李明:我认为,随着人工智能和机器学习的发展,未来的综合信息门户可能会更加智能化,能够自动识别数据模式并提供预测性分析。而源码的开发也会更加注重自动化和微服务架构,以提高系统的灵活性和可扩展性。
张伟:听起来很有前景。谢谢你今天的分享,让我对综合信息门户和源码在数据分析中的作用有了更深入的理解。
李明:不客气,张伟。如果你还有其他问题,随时可以问我。